What To Do After A Car Accident In Troy, MO

Following a car accident, it is common for people to be stunned and unsure of how to proceed. However, having dealt with many car accident clients across Troy, MO, the staff at Combs Waterkotte suggests that all our clients take these steps after their car accident:

  1. Make sure you are safe. Pull over to somewhere where you will not obstruct traffic, if you can, and check to see if you have suffered any injuries.
  2. Call 911. Not only will you need to talk with police and get a full report of your car accident, but if you or a passenger is severely hurt you may need to have an ambulance dispatched. When the police arrive, tell the truth about the accident but avoid saying anything unnecessary: statements that imply guilt can and will be used against you by insurance companies when finding fault.
  3. Collect all relevant information. Exchange not only your license, registration, and insurance details, which you are required to do by law, but also phone numbers and other contact details.
  4. Take photos. Camera phones now being ubiquitious means that it is very simple to document your Troy, MO accident and gather evidence. Take photos of the site of your accident, skid marks, and the full extent of your damage. If you can find witnesses, it is a good idea to record their accounts of the accident, as it can help your case immensely.
  5. Get medical care. If you were injured as a result of your Troy car accident, immediately seek out emergency medical care. For more minor injuries, a local urgent care center is a more affordable and convenient option than an ER visit. However, more severe or bigger will likely necessitate a trip to the hospital, or potentially a visit to your primary care physician.
  6. Contact a car accident lawyer. The sooner you talk to a trustworthy and understanding Troy, MO car accident lawyer, the sooner they can start working on your case and allow you to begin the recovery process.

As well as these steps, our firm urges all our clients to hold on to the following documents. They can help immensely when discussing settlement terms, or to give a more complete idea of the effect a car accident in Troy, MO had on your life.

  • Medical documentation
  • Pictures of the accident scene
  • The full police report of the accident
  • Witness statements
  • All medical-related bills (ambulance fees, rehab costs, medications, etc.)
  • Doctor’s reports and observations
  • Repair records
  • Incidental bills such as rental car receipts
  • Lost earning opportunities
  • Records of pain and suffering resulting from your accident

What Damages Can I Recover After A Car Accident?

In general, there are five kinds of damages an accident victim can claim following a car accident in Troy, MO. These are:

  • Medical damages: these are not only restricted to hospital bills or doctor’s visits, either. An auto accident victim can claim reimbursement for prescriptions, visits to mental health professionals, rehab or physical therapy to fully recover from accident injuries, and necessary medical equipment such as crutches, as well.
  • Lost wages/earning potential: in general this is based off of what you were earning prior to the accident, the extent of the impact the accident had on your ability to fully perform work, and how the lasting effects of your accident/injuries may prevent you from working to your full potential in the future.
  • Property damage: this includes repair/replacement of your car as well as any/all additional items that were damaged as a result of your Troy auto accident.
  • Pain and suffering: these damages can be hard to put into words, since for the most part the amount of anguish a Troy, MO victim goes through after an accident varies from person to person. As a rule, though, recording changes in personality, attitude, and mental health is a good rule of thumb.
  • Disability or disfigurement: in more severe cases, a Troy, MO car accident may result in a victim sustaining life-changing injuries. While in a substantial number of cases those injuries are permanent and compensation cannot take away the immense pain and difficulty these injuries cause, it can help provide an accident victim more freedom to adapt to their new normal.

It is also critical to note that Missouri is a comparative fault state, which means that the quantity of damages one or more parties receive is reduced based on the level they were at fault they were for causing a car accident. Missouri is a pure comparative fault state, which allows for even someone who was judged 99% responsible for an accident to collect a commensurate amount of damages.
